The Board Director Training Institute of Japan (BDTI), a non-profit Japanese “public interest” organization certified by the government, was established in 2009 by experts and opinion leaders active in academic and business circles. BDTI’s mission is to increase trust between corporations and the public, and facilitate the safe, sustainable and ethical development of the Japanese economy and Japanese companies, by improving corporate governance and accelerating the spread of effective management methods.  We believe that director training is the key to doing these things while also enhancing corporate value.

Since BDTI’s establishment, we have been fortunate enough to receive the support and participation of senior leaders (and leading firms) around the world, all of whom share our purpose and sense of mission.

BDTI offers (a) intensive “director training” programs that combine corporate governance know-how with global management methods; (b) customized programs for enhancing director skills, or governance and compliance awareness; and  (c) seminars on specific topics, led by lecturers who are experts in each respective field.  BDTI has corporate and individual memberships, which allow members to receive 30% discounts on courses that are open to the public.

In order to spread knowledge about governance and related management methods widely, BDTI also provides low-cost E-Learning Courses providing core knowledge about the Company Law, Securities Law, Corporate Governance (Basics), and Corporate Governance (Practice)  which can be purchased on either on (a) a per-person, per-course basis or (b) an “Unlimited e-Learning” basis, for the entire company and its subsidiaries.  We believe this is one of the best ways that companies can cultivate a healthy “corporate governance culture”.

Companies (and investing institutions) that wish to take advantage of BDTI’s training programs and seminars  can become corporate participating members of BDTI.  Membership allows corporations (or investors’ portfolio companies)  to receive 30% discounts on courses that are open to the public.   BDTI also provides a  “BDTI Director Bank.
